Frequently Asked Questions

Can poor roof ventilation really cause attic mold problems?

Improper ventilation on 4/12 pitch roofs creates thermal stratification where hot, moist air stagnates in attic spaces. The 2018 IRC with North Carolina amendments requires specific intake and exhaust ratios to maintain air exchange. Inadequate ventilation leads to condensation on roof deck undersides, promoting mold growth on OSB and reducing insulation R-values. Properly balanced systems use continuous ridge and soffit vents to create convective airflow, preventing moisture accumulation that compromises both roof structure and indoor air quality.

How do modern roof inspections differ from traditional methods?

Standard UAS drone photogrammetry creates millimeter-accurate 3D models that identify sub-surface moisture in architectural shingles invisible during walk-over inspections. Thermal imaging detects trapped moisture in OSB decking before visible sagging occurs. High-resolution imagery documents granule loss patterns indicating advanced UV degradation. This data-driven approach prevents unnecessary tear-offs while accurately targeting repair areas, extending service life through precise interventions rather than complete replacement.

Should I consider solar shingles instead of traditional roofing?

Traditional architectural shingles offer proven performance at lower initial cost, while solar shingles integrate energy generation with weather protection. Dallas's net metering policies and the 30% federal investment tax credit improve solar economics, but solar shingles typically carry higher per-watt costs than rack-mounted panels. The decision balances energy independence goals against upfront investment, considering that solar-ready roofs with reinforced framing accommodate future panel additions without compromising the primary waterproofing layer.

What are the current code requirements for roof installations in Dallas?

Gaston County Building Inspections Department enforces the 2018 IRC with North Carolina amendments, requiring specific ice and water shield applications in eaves and valleys. The North Carolina Licensing Board for General Contractors mandates proper flashing integration at wall and chimney intersections. Current code specifies minimum fastener patterns for OSB decking in wind zones and requires sealed roof deck systems in FORTIFIED installations. These requirements address documented failure points from past storm events, ensuring installations meet engineered performance standards rather than minimum manufacturer specifications.

Why are my homeowner insurance premiums increasing so much in Dallas?

North Carolina's 18% average premium trend reflects insurers' response to increased severe weather claims. Upgrading to an IBHS FORTIFIED Home standard roof through the NC Department of Insurance grant program directly reduces premiums by demonstrating enhanced resilience. FORTIFIED roofs feature sealed decking, enhanced fastening, and impact-resistant shingles that statistically reduce claim frequency. Insurers recognize these roofs as lower-risk investments, translating to measurable savings on annual premiums.

What makes a roof truly storm-resistant for Dallas weather?

Dallas falls within ASCE 7-22's 115 mph wind zone, requiring specific deck attachment and shingle fastening protocols. Class 4 impact-resistant shingles withstand 1.25-1.5 inch hail stones common during April-June thunderstorms, preventing the granular loss that accelerates UV degradation. These shingles maintain water-shedding capability after impact, reducing emergency repair needs.
